Q: Is 50,296,233 a Prime Number?
A: No, 50,296,233 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 50296233 can be evenly divided by 1 3 13 39 599 1,797 2,153 6,459 7,787 23,361 27,989 83,967 1,289,647 3,868,941 16,765,411 and 50,296,233, with no remainder.
Since 50,296,233 cannot be divided by just 1 and 50,296,233, it is not a prime number.
